                                   ARTICLE II

                                  ORGANIZATION

                  SECTION 2.1 Name. The Trust created hereby shall be known as
"Banc One HELOC Trust 199[__-__]", in which name the Owner Trustee may conduct
the business of the Trust, make and execute contracts and other instruments on
behalf of the Trust and sue and be sued on behalf of the Trust.

                  SECTION 2.2 Office. The office of the Trust shall be in care
of the Owner Trustee at its Corporate Trust Office or at such other address in
Delaware as the Owner Trustee may designate by written notice to the
Certificateholders and the Depositor.

                  SECTION 2.3 Purposes and Powers. (a) The purpose of the Trust
is to engage in the following activities:

                  (i) to accept the transfer of, manage and hold or, pursuant to
         the Pooling and Servicing Agreement, cause the Servicer to manage, the
         Mortgage Loans;

                  (ii) to issue the Notes pursuant to the Indenture and the
         Certificates pursuant to this Agreement, and to sell the Notes pursuant
         to the Underwriting Agreement dated as of [_____________ __,] 199[__]
         among the Trust, the Depositor, [_________________] and
         [_____________________________] (hereinafter the "Underwriting
         Agreement"), and to register the transfer of or exchange the Notes and
         the Certificates;

                  (iii) to acquire certain property and assets from the
         Depositor pursuant to the Pooling and Servicing Agreement, to make
         payments to the Noteholders and the
   3
         Certificateholders and to pay the organizational, start-up and
         transactional expenses of the Trust;

                  (iv) to assign, grant, transfer, pledge, mortgage and convey
         the Collateral pursuant to the terms of the Indenture and to hold,
         manage and distribute to the Certificateholders pursuant to the terms
         of this Agreement and the Pooling and Servicing Agreement any portion
         of the assets of the Trust released from the lien of, and remitted to
         the Trust pursuant to, the Indenture;

                  (v) to enter into and perform its obligations under the Basic
         Documents (as defined in the Indenture) to which it is to be a party
         and the Underwriting Agreement;

                  (vi) to engage in those activities, including entering into
         agreements, that are necessary, suitable or convenient to accomplish
         the foregoing or are incidental thereto or connected therewith; and

                  (vii) subject to compliance with the Basic Documents, to
         engage in such other activities as may be required in connection with
         conservation of the assets of the Trust and the making of distributions
         to the Certificateholders and the Noteholders.

The Trust is hereby authorized to engage in the foregoing activities and shall
not engage in any activity other than in connection with the foregoing or other
than as required or authorized by the terms of this Agreement or the Basic
Documents.

                  SECTION 2.4 Appointment of Owner Trustee. The Depositor hereby
appoints the Owner Trustee as trustee of the Trust effective as of the date
hereof, to have all the rights, powers and duties set forth herein. The Owner
Trustee hereby accepts its appointment subject to the terms and conditions
hereof.

                  SECTION 2.5 Initial Capital Contribution of Assets of the
Trust. Pursuant to the Organizational Trust Agreement, the Depositor transferred
to the Owner Trustee, as of the date hereof, the sum of $1.00. The Owner Trustee
hereby acknowledges receipt in trust from the Depositor, as of the date hereof,
of the foregoing contributions which shall constitute the initial assets of the
Trust and shall be deposited in the Certificate Distribution Account. The
Depositor shall pay organizational expenses of the Trust as they may arise or
shall, upon the request of the Owner Trustee, promptly reimburse the Owner
Trustee for any such expenses paid by the Owner Trustee.

                  SECTION 2.6 Declaration of Trust. The Owner Trustee hereby
declares that it shall hold the assets of the Trust in trust upon and subject to
the conditions set forth herein for the use and benefit of the
Certificateholders, subject to the obligations of the Trust under the Basic
Documents. The Owner Trustee has, pursuant to authority in the Organizational
Trust Agreement, filed the Certificate of Trust. The Trust shall constitute a
business trust under the Business Trust Statute and this Agreement shall
constitute the governing instrument of such business trust. Solely for United
States federal and state income tax purposes, the Depositor's contribution of
$1.00 to the Trust in exchange for an interest in the Trust and the relations
created by the arrangements between the Trust, the Servicer and the Depositor is
intended to constitute the formation of a partnership. The sale by the Depositor
of Class [__] Certificates is




                                       2
   4
intended to effect a termination of that partnership under Code Section 708 and
the creation of a new tax partnership (the "Tax Partnership") whose partners are
the Class[__] Certificateholders and the Class [__] Certificateholders. The Tax
Partnership shall be governed as set forth in the Tax Partnership Agreement
attached hereto as Annex A.

                  SECTION 6.14 Underwriting Agreement. For purposes of this
Article VI, the term "Basic Document" shall be deemed to include the
Underwriting Agreement.


                                  ARTICLE VII

                         TERMINATION OF TRUST AGREEMENT

                  SECTION 7.1 Termination of Trust Agreement.

                  (a) This Agreement (other than Article VI) and the Trust shall
terminate and be of no further force or effect on the earlier of: (i) the final
distribution by the Owner Trustee of all moneys or other property or proceeds of
the assets of the Trust in accordance with the terms of the Indenture, the
Pooling and Servicing Agreement (including the exercise of the Class [__]
Certificateholder of its option to purchase the Mortgage Loans pursuant to
Section 10.01 of the Pooling and Servicing Agreement) and Article V, (ii) at the
time provided in Section 7.2 or (iii) the expiration of 21 years from the death
of the last survivor of Joseph P. Kennedy, former Ambassador to the Court of St.
James, living on the date of this Trust Agreement. The bankruptcy, liquidation,
dissolution, death or incapacity of any Certificateholder, other than the
Depositor as described in Section 7.2, shall not (x) operate to terminate this
Agreement or the Trust, nor (y) entitle such Certificateholder's legal
representatives or heirs to claim an accounting or to take any action or
proceeding in any court for a partition or winding up of all or any part of the
Trust or the assets of the Trust or (z) otherwise affect the rights, obligations
and liabilities of the parties hereto.

                  (b) Except as provided in Section 7.1(a), neither the
Depositor nor any Certificateholder shall be entitled to revoke or terminate the
Trust.

                  (c) Notice of any termination of the Trust, specifying the
Payment Date upon which the Certificateholders shall surrender their
Certificates to the Paying Agent for payment of the final distribution and
cancellation, shall be given by the Owner Trustee by letter to the Credit
Enhancer and the Certificateholders mailed within five Business Days of receipt
of notice of such termination from the Servicer given pursuant to subsection
10.01 of the Pooling and Servicing Agreement, stating: (i) the Payment Date upon
or with respect to which final payment of the Certificates shall be made upon
presentation and surrender of the Certificates at the office of the Paying Agent
therein designated; (ii) the amount of any such final payment; and (iii) that
the Record Date otherwise applicable to such Payment Date is not applicable,
payments being made only upon presentation and surrender of the Certificates at
the office of the Paying Agent therein specified. The Owner Trustee shall give
such notice to the Certificate Registrar (if other than the Owner Trustee) and
the Paying Agent at the time such notice is given to



                                       24
   26
Certificateholders. Upon presentation and surrender of the Certificates, the
Paying Agent shall cause to be distributed to Certificateholders amounts
distributable on such Payment Date pursuant to Section 5.2.

                  (d) If all of the Certificateholders shall not surrender their
Certificates for cancellation within six months after the date specified in the
above mentioned written notice, the Owner Trustee shall give a second written
notice to the remaining Certificateholders to surrender their Certificates for
cancellation and receive the final distribution with respect thereto. If within
one year after the second notice all the Certificates shall not have been
surrendered for cancellation, the Owner Trustee may take appropriate steps, or
may appoint an agent to take appropriate steps, to contact the remaining
Certificateholders concerning surrender of their Certificates, and the cost
thereof shall be paid out of the funds and other assets that shall remain
subject to this Agreement. Subject to applicable laws with respect to escheat of
funds, any funds remaining in the Trust after exhaustion of such remedies in the
preceding sentence shall be deemed property of the Depositor and distributed by
the Owner Trustee to the Depositor.

                  (e) Each Certificateholder is required, and hereby agrees, to
return to the Owner Trustee, any Certificate with respect to which the Owner
Trustee has made the final distribution due thereon. Any such Certificate as to
which the Owner Trustee has made the final distribution thereon shall be deemed
canceled and shall no longer be outstanding for any purpose of this Agreement,
whether or not such Certificate is ever returned to the Owner Trustee.

                  (f) Upon the winding up of the Trust and its termination, the
Owner Trustee shall cause the Certificate of Trust to be canceled by filing a
certificate of cancellation with the Secretary of State in accordance with the
provisions of Section 3810 of the Business Trust Statute.

          SECTION 7.2 Dissolution upon Bankruptcy of the Depositor. This
Agreement shall be terminated in accordance with Section 7.1 90 days after the
occurrence of an Insolvency Event with respect to the Depositor, unless, before
the end of such 90 day period, the Owner Trustee shall have received written
instructions from (a) each of the Certificateholders (other than the Depositor)
and (b) each of the Noteholders, to the effect that each such party disapproves
of the liquidation of the Mortgage Loans and termination of the Trust. Promptly
after the occurrence of any Insolvency Event with respect to either Depositor:
(i) the Depositor shall give the Credit Enhancer, the Indenture Trustee, the
Rating Agencies and the Owner Trustee written notice of such Insolvency Event;
(ii) the Owner Trustee shall, upon the receipt of such written notice from the
Depositor, give prompt written notice to the Certificateholders and the
Indenture Trustee of the occurrence of such event and (iii) the Indenture
Trustee shall, upon receipt of written notice of such Insolvency Event from the
Owner Trustee or the Depositor, give prompt written notice to the Noteholders of
the occurrence of such event pursuant to Section 6.12 of the Indenture;
provided, however, that any failure to give a notice required by this sentence
shall not prevent or delay in any manner a termination of the Trust pursuant to
the first sentence of this Section 7.2. Upon a termination pursuant to this
Section 7.2, the Owner Trustee shall direct the Indenture Trustee promptly to
sell the assets of the Trust (other than the Accounts and the Certificate
Distribution Account) in a commercially reasonable manner and on commercially
reasonable terms. The proceeds of any such sale, disposition or liquidation of
the assets of the Trust shall be treated as collections on the Mortgage Loans
and deposited in the



                                       25
   27
Principal and Interest Account pursuant to Section [___] of the Pooling and
Servicing Agreement.
